Compare all specifications:
1993 Acura Integra | 2004 Holden Astra | |
Make | Acura | Holden |
Model | Integra | Astra |
Year Released | 1993 | 2004 |
Body Type | Hatchback | Hatchback |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1595 cc | 1796 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 168 HP | 124 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Doors | 3 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4400 mm | 4260 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1720 mm | 1800 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1330 mm | 1470 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2560 mm | 2620 mm |
